Towards Better Open-Ended Text Generation: A Multicriteria Evaluation Framework

由于大型语言模型的兴起,开放式文本生成已成为自然语言处理中的重要任务。然而,由于常用指标(如连贯性、多样性、困惑度)之间存在权衡,评估模型质量和解码策略仍具挑战性。本文针对开放式文本生成的多指标评估问题,提出了新的相对与绝对排名方法。具体而言,我们采用基于偏序关系的基准测试方法,并引入一种新综合指标,以平衡现有自动评估指标,提供更全面的文本生成质量评估。实验表明,所提方法能稳健比较不同解码策略,为开放式文本生成任务中的模型选择提供有效指导。论文还展望了文本生成评估方法的未来方向,并公开了代码、数据集与模型。

Open-ended text generation has become a prominent task in natural language processing due to the rise of powerful (large) language models. However, evaluating the quality of these models and the employed decoding strategies remains challenging due to trade-offs among widely used metrics such as coherence, diversity, and perplexity. This paper addresses the specific problem of multicriteria evaluation for open-ended text generation, proposing novel methods for both relative and absolute rankings of decoding methods. Specifically, we employ benchmarking approaches based on partial orderings and present a new summary metric to balance existing automatic indicators, providing a more holistic evaluation of text generation quality. Our experiments demonstrate that the proposed approaches offer a robust way to compare decoding strategies and serve as valuable tools to guide model selection for open-ended text generation tasks. We suggest future directions for improving evaluation methodologies in text generation and make our code, datasets, and models publicly available.
